Search
Write a publication
Pull to refresh
2
0
Send message

Реальная эффективность Qwen 2.5 Coder против ChatGPT (или можно ли сэкономить 20$?)

Level of difficultyEasy
Reading time8 min
Views21K

Можно ли сэкономить 20$ и заменить ChatGPT локальным Qwen 2.5 Coder? Попробуем проверить логику моделей!

Читать далее

Практическое обучение с подкреплением: от забав с MuJoCo'м до битв на арене

Level of difficultyMedium
Reading time14 min
Views3.7K

Добрый день, уважаемые хабровчане! Я хочу поделиться с вами очень интересным проектом, над которым работал в последнее время.

В первой статье я не буду сильно углубляться в технические подробности, а вместо этого постараюсь провести вас по пути, который я прошел при реализации своего пайплайна для обучения нейросеток, сражающихся друг с другом на арене. Весь код доступен на моем GitHub и готов к использованию, поэтому вы сразу сможете обучить чемпиона и поучаствовать в сражении!

Готовы? Тогда — вперед!

Внимание! Тяжёлые гифки под катом.

На арену!

Гравитационные маневры

Level of difficultyMedium
Reading time9 min
Views4.4K

Гравитационные маневры представляют собой технологию, используемую космическими миссиями для изменения орбиты и скорости космических аппаратов с минимальными затратами энергии. Эта техника включает в себя использование силы гравитации планет или других небесных тел для увеличения скорости космического аппарата при его прохождении вблизи этих объектов. Гравитационные маневры позволяют не только эффективно управлять траекторией полета, но и значительно увеличивать дальность путешествий, что особенно актуально для межпланетных миссий. Правильное планирование таких маневров может сократить время полета и сократить затраты на топливо, что делает их важным инструментом в астрономии и исследовании космоса.

Читать далее

Упрощаем «простой» ELF

Level of difficultyMedium
Reading time13 min
Views8.2K

Давайте-ка напишем простую программу для Linux. Насколько трудной она может быть? Только тут надо учесть, что простота противоположна сложности, но не трудности*, и создать нечто простое на удивление трудно. А что останется, если избавиться от сложности стандартной библиотеки, всех современных средств безопасности, отладочной информации и механизмов обработки ошибок?
Читать дальше →

Деградация организации заметок одного программиста

Level of difficultyEasy
Reading time8 min
Views32K

О ведении и организации заметок пишут книги, создают приложения и плагины, продают курсы. Кажется, все должно быть значительно проще. Я сознательно веду заметки более 15 лет и хочу поделиться опытом.

Читать далее

Сделай сам: фреоновый чиллер из кондиционера

Reading time3 min
Views8.1K


Идея переделки системы охлаждения лазерного станка витала в голове уже давно, но, как водится, руки за головой не поспевают. Первоначально работу по охлаждению «трубы» (лазерного излучателя) выполнял простенький китайский чиллер, точь-в-точь как на картинке.
Читать дальше →

О мостиковых схемах и асинхронной логике

Level of difficultyEasy
Reading time11 min
Views3.1K

Александр Кушнеров
10.01.2025

 Аннотация – Дизайн замкнутых комбинационных схем основан на законах поглощения конъюнкций и дизъюнкций. Если в такой схеме используется только один выход, то её транзисторная реализация будет избыточной, а граф этой реализации будет содержать ложные циклы. Значения на выходах комбинационной схемы, в том числе и замкнутой, можно считать правильными лишь через какое-то время, необходимое для завершения всех переходных процессов. В статье показано как дополнить замкнутую схему индикатором завершения переходных процессов, т.е. сделать её асинхронной.

1. Введение

Замыкание выхода комбинационной схемы на один или несколько её входов может дать новую комбинационную схему. Поскольку данные обрабатываются от входов к выходам, обратную связь можно представить как направленную петлю на графе. С другой стороны, графы, которые задают контактные мостиковые схемы, содержат не направленные петли (циклы). Именно из-за петель такие схемы часто являются минимальными. Преобразование графа мостиковой схемы в последовательно-параллельный соответствует схеме на логических элементах. Это преобразование размыкает все петли и называется декомпозиция в базисе И/ИЛИ. Мы будем рассматривать декомпозицию, которая даёт минимальное количество логических элементов. Чтобы корректно замкнуть полученные схемы нужно выполнить определённые условия. В качестве этих условий мы используем известную замкнутую схему.

В инженерной практике релейно-контактные мостиковые схемы начали использоваться по крайней мере со второй половины 1890-х годов [1]. Однако, привлечение булевой алгебры для их анализа и синтеза состоялось лишь во второй половине 1930-х годов [2]. Рассмотрим простейшую мостиковую схему из пяти замыкающих ключей (контактов), назовём её K5. Каждый ключ в этой схеме управляется своей переменной. Присвоить переменные можно например так, как показано в Табл. 1. Последовательное соединение ключей записывается как произведение переменных, а параллельное – как сумма. Таким образом, чтобы записать булеву функцию схемы в дизъюнктивной нормальной форме (ДНФ), нужно найти все возможные пути от входа к выходу.

Читать далее

Забытые технологии: CGI

Reading time9 min
Views7.7K

Навеяло комментариями: у людей стойкая ассоциация между Perl как языком и CGI как технологией, использовавшейся в начале веб‑времен.

Всё логично: на тот момент Perl был одним из немногих распространенных скриптовых языков, и естественно что на нем делать CGI‑скрипты было удобнее, чем на shell, например.
Но это не означает что одно к другому было гвоздями прибито.

А вообще технология была по‑своему хорошая: установили вебсервер (как правило — Apache), настроили каталог, из которого запускаются скрипты — и запускай что хочешь.

Попробую показать к чему можно приспособить это в наше время...

Читать далее

Уничтожение рака простаты с использованием струи пара

Level of difficultyEasy
Reading time2 min
Views2.2K

Рак простаты обычно побеждают хирургическим путем и/или лучевой терапией, но у обоих методов могут возникнуть побочные эффекты. Клиническое исследование изучает безопасность и эффективность уничтожения рака простаты струей пара. Клиническое испытание проходит на людях

Читать далее

Редчайший миниатюрный ARM-ноутбук из Кореи, который умеет превращаться в планшет — смотрим на Inkel MU-d

Level of difficultyMedium
Reading time9 min
Views12K

Недавно я искал интересные девайсы на китайском аналоге авито и нашёл очень занимательный и необычный гаджет всего-лишь за 400 рублей (4$) в состоянии ‭«на запчасти‭». Меня сразу привлёк интересный форм-фактор устройства в формате ноутбука-трансформера и надпись, которая вызывает в моей голове ‭«Neuron activation‭» — Windows CE. Когда девайс приехал ко мне и я принялся его разбирать, я был в шоке от того, какой диковинный процессор в нём используется и насколько круто этот миниатюрный красавец спроектирован. Сегодня мы с вами узнаем распиновку неизвестного разъёма зарядки без схемы на устройство, проведем моддинг с заменой на более привычный MicroUSB и посмотрим что-же за диковинный аппарат придумали корейцы в далёком 2008 году!

Читать далее

Toshiba T3200 — 10КГ портативности из 1987

Level of difficultyEasy
Reading time3 min
Views7.5K

В промоматериалах производителя, аппарат называли «The Spacesaver» — («экономящий место» вольный перевод автора). По замыслу создателей, аппарат должен был заменить десктоп, для чего в числе прочего — оборудован двумя слотами ISA (один на 8 второй на 16bit). Характеристики были вполне на уровне 286-й на 12МГц, 1МБ озу с расширением до 4МБ

Читать далее

Iomega home media drive — восстановление и открытие чакр

Level of difficultyEasy
Reading time4 min
Views3.7K

Лет 15 назад мною в подарок моей будущей супруге было куплено такое устройство — «Сетевое хранилище Iomega Home Media Network Hard Drive». В принципе, нормальная железяка, но она не нашла своего места. Главная проблема заключалась в том, что по самбе хранилище работало неоправданно медленно, а веб‑интерфейс — это не для ежедневного использования.

Так и валялось оно без дела, а когда я, спустя годы, попытался его включить, выяснилось, что диск приказал долго жить.

Спустя ещё пару лет было решено, что негоже вещи кануть в Лету, не оставив следа. Ну а заодно, как водится, можно хорошенько поковыряться во внутрянке, авось чего интересного выяснится.

Читать далее

Как поднять на виртуальном сервере собственную интернет-машину времени с помощью ArchiveBox

Level of difficultyEasy
Reading time4 min
Views9.7K

Всем привет, на связи THE.Hosting! Меня зовут Игорь, начиная с 2024 года я работаю в техподдержке компании. А начиная с этого дня я еще буду писать для нашей нашей странички на Хабре ;)

И знаете, что я заметил за время работы? Многие считают, что виртуальный сервер или даже выделенный — это не очень интересно. Ну что максимум на нем можно сделать? Разместить интернет-магазин или любой другой сайт — так себе развлечение. 

Поэтому я взял на себя задачу добавить немного рок-н-ролла и показать, что сервер — это на самом деле гигабайты свежей информации виртуальная техно-лаборатория интересных проектов, экспериментов и даже профессионального роста. Главное, чтобы под рукой был смартфон или компьютер с установленным openssh. И это все по цене пары кружек кофе в месяц. 

В первом выпуске я расскажу о ArchiveBox — сервисе, который позволяет самостоятельно запустить аналог Wayback Machine. 

Читать далее

Безопасная лазерная коррекция = SMILE Pro на VISUMAX 800

Level of difficultyEasy
Reading time19 min
Views7.4K

Революция в лазерной коррекции зрения: VISUMAX 800 от Carl Zeiss с технологией SMILE Pro устанавливает новые стандарты безопасности. Представьте операцию, которая длится всего 8 секунд, обеспечивает минимальное воздействие на глаз и позволяет забыть о проблемах со зрением. Это не фантастика, а реальность, доступная уже сегодня. Давайте разберемся, почему SMILE Pro на VISUMAX 800 считается одной из самых безопасных технологий лазерной коррекции зрения.

В этой статье расскажем о новейшей технологии SMILE Pro на VISUMAX 800, которая открывает новую эру в лазерной коррекции зрения. Эта инновационная система сочетает в себе проверенную безопасность метода SMILE с передовыми достижениями в области лазерной хирургии, предлагая беспрецедентную скорость, точность и комфорт как для пациентов, так и для хирургов.

Читать далее

Пишем легаси с нуля на С++, не вызывая подозрение у санитаров. 01 — Маленькая программа

Level of difficultyEasy
Reading time4 min
Views14K

Приветствую, Хабравчане!

Решил сделать цикл статей по написанию на С++, различных небольших программ. Под новые и старые ОС. Мне кажется мы стали забывать как раньше программировали:) Для себя определил несколько важных критериев.

Loading, please wait

Crowbar circuit: надежная DIY-защита для цепи питания 12 В. Как это работает?

Reading time4 min
Views13K

Привет, Хабр! Это Антон Комаров, автор команды спецпроектов МТС Диджитал. Сегодня я расскажу об одной любопытной самоделке, которой пользуются радиолюбители для защиты трансиверов от скачков напряжения по линии 12 вольт. Ее называют Crowbar circuit: действует она точно как монтировка, брошенная на клеммы. Звучит, конечно, необычно, но работает!

Читать далее

Разбираем китайский аппарат для удаления татуировок на основе неодимового лазера

Level of difficultyEasy
Reading time7 min
Views11K

Как быть, если ваша татуировка, скажем так, устарела, и вам она больше не дорога как память? Нужно её свести! Но как? Для сведения татуировок предприимчивые китайцы в настоящее время предлагают относительно бюджетные аппараты. Давайте посмотрим, как устроен такой аппарат из Поднебесной и для чего он может пригодиться дома.

Читать далее

Cовмещаем Haproxy, Vless, WebSocket, VPN и сайт на одном порту

Level of difficultyHard
Reading time13 min
Views24K

Cовмещаем Vless, WebSocket, VPN и сайт на одном порту средствами Haproxy, создаем альтернативу VPN на основе WebSocket.

Читать далее

Мои результаты тестов сравнения быстродействия NVME-over-TCP и NVME-over-RDMA

Level of difficultyEasy
Reading time3 min
Views5.8K

На хабре уже было несколько статей, посвящённых технологии NVME over Fabric, которая в последнее время становится всё более популярной для сетевых дисковых подключений. Мы сейчас строим некую новую систему и у меня возникла мысль протестировать и сравнить несколько различных настроек. Возможно, кому-то из коллег будут полезны полученные мной результаты.

Читать далее

Information

Rating
Does not participate
Registered
Activity